U.S. Senators Challenge SEC Over Alleged Misconduct in Crypto Enforcement Action

Sharp criticism has emerged from the highest echelons of the United States government, with Bipartisan Senators collectively raising their voices to question the professional integrity of the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). Their scrutiny targets the SEC’s actions against the cryptocurrency firm Debt Box.

The bipartisan bevy of senators wrote a critical letter to SEC Chairman Gary Gensler, spotlighting concerns following a court’s findings. The legal proceedings revealed the SEC might have made “materially false and misleading representations” during its enforcement action.
